The Opportunity :
As an Associate within our Venture and Growth Equity Team, you will assist the deal leaders in sourcing, evaluating and managing venture and growth equity investment opportunities (funds, co-investments and secondaries). The role will also include aspects of portfolio management, client communication and business development support.
Your responsibilities will be to :
- Support all aspects of venture and growth equity investments, including funds, co-investments and secondaries.
- Conduct thorough due diligence on potential investment opportunities, including financial analysis, market research, and competitive assessments.
- Participate in due diligence meetings with General Partners and management teams.
- Prepare detailed investment memos and presentations to support decision-making process.
- Assist in sourcing new investment opportunities and managing investment pipeline.
- Support the management of existing investments by monitoring performance, analyzing financial reports and tracking updates.
- Assist in preparing and presenting client materials.
- Manage day to day communication with General Partners.
- Assist in the management and training of Analysts.
- Oversee special projects including, but not limited to, industry analyses, specific geographical studies, marketing materials and strategic deployment plans.
- Stay current with industry news, emerging technologies, and market dynamics to provide actionable insights.
